Output 089e5fb91d338dbdb32919f857e4f8d2e8382f5bb140a5aae125dada44213f45:0

value
18500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07bf57b85660db4d34959d5dfa8382606f88cd75 OP_EQUALVERIFY OP_CHECKSIG
address
1hxx4h9nTmv59vPRW7KfyntppUJjiRwif
transaction
089e5fb91d338dbdb32919f857e4f8d2e8382f5bb140a5aae125dada44213f45
confirmations
695712
spent
true